BISON ARRIVE FOR BREEDING PROGRAMME IN RUSSIA


Bison are the latest live animal shipment to be transported by Volga-Dnepr Airlines, carried onboard an IL-76TD-90VD freighter to Yakutsk in Russia from Edmonton, Canada.


The 30 bison calves travelled in special containers that had been previously delivered to Canada by Volga-Dnepr Airlines. The animals were accompanied by veterinaries and representatives of the Canadian Elk Island National Park to ensure their health and comfort during


the journey. The IL-76TD-90VD fl ight was organised by the Russian broker Aerologic Line, who chartered the Volga- Dnepr aircraft on behalf of the Ministry of Nature of the Republic of Yakutia.


The animals will take part in a breeding programme in Yakutia. The bison is currently a near threatened species according to the International Union for Conservation of Nature red list. Earlier in 2006 and 2011, 60 calves were donated by the Canadian Government to the Ust-Buotama and Tympynai reservations in the Republic of Yakutia to help re- establish the Eurasian population of bisons. The animals settled well in their new surroundings and this resulted in a successful repopulation programme.


A further delivery of bison to Yakutia is scheduled for 2015.

THIRD BOEING 747-8F JOINS ABC


AirBridgeCargo Airlines (ABC) has taken delivery of its third Boeing 747-8 Freighter from Boeing in Everett, USA. The aircraft made its fi rst commercial fl ight on a route from Seattle-Hong Kong- Moscow.


The new aircraft will serve ABC’s existing route network linking Europe and Asia with AirBridgeCargo’s hubs in Moscow.


Delivery of the third Boeing 747-8F is the latest step by ABC to replace older freighters in its fl eet with new generation cargo aircraft. The addition of the new 747-8 reduces the average age of the fl eet to 4.1 years. AirBridgeCargo’s fl eet now consists of 11 Boeing 747 aircraft (fi ve Boeing 747-400ERF, three Boeing 747-400F and three Boeing 747-8F).
